| Stretch: | Bridge rd to Bee Branch or Sequatchie Cove Creamery |
| Difficulty: | Class IV+ to V |
| Distance: | 3.6 miles (or 0.5 miles hiking plus another 4.4 miles of paddling) |
| Flows: | 0.5' to 1.5' give or take on the put-in gauge. Look for 2+ inches of rain within previous 12-24 hours. |
| Gradient: | 188 fpm average on Pocket (Bedrock is 277 fpm from 1-1.7 mile, Bedrock is 254 fpm from 2.2-3.6 mile). Paddle out is 55 fpm. |
| Put-in: | Bridge Rd off of Pocket Rd |
| Take-out: | Bee Branch dirt road or downriver on Coppinger Cove Rd near Sequatchie Cove Creamery. |
| Shuttle: | 20.1 miles (30 minutes one way) or 1.9 miles driving plus 1.5 miles of hiking with 700 ft elevation gain |
| Season: | Winter, and Spring from rain |
